Output c3b9cac8e8940671d7de9b4300e87165ea5883c694f047b35aa6ba477c0ee029:0

value
19986917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4bf576ff6ee2ae0e81a57d851a7469ecca390a OP_EQUAL
address
3Jg4bwKksdBkFpEMvkWp5XME3cNzM1Cusw
transaction
c3b9cac8e8940671d7de9b4300e87165ea5883c694f047b35aa6ba477c0ee029
spent
true